Abstract

Official abstract text for this publication.

There is provided a method for producing a zeolite more excellent in moisture absorption characteristics. The method includes physically pulverizing a zeolite that has a gradient of a Na/Si value from a surface of the zeolite in a depth direction, that has a proportion of the Na/Si value at a depth of 10 nm from the surface to the Na/Si value at the surface of 90% or more, and that has a proportion of the Na/Si value at a depth of 30 nm from the surface to the Na/Si value at the surface of 70% or more, the Na/Si value representing a composition ratio between Na and Si, and crystallizing the physically pulverized zeolite.

First claim

Opening claim text (preview).

1 . A method for producing a zeolite, the method comprising: physically pulverizing a zeolite that has a gradient of a Na/Si value from a surface of the zeolite in a depth direction, that has a proportion of the Na/Si value at a depth of 10 nm from the surface to the Na/Si value at the surface of 90% or more, and that has a proportion of the Na/Si value at a depth of 30 nm from the surface to the Na/Si value at the surface of 70% or more, the Na/Si value representing a composition ratio between Na and Si; and crystallizing the physically pulverized zeolite. 2 . The method for producing a zeolite according to claim 1 , wherein the Na/Si value at a depth of 10 nm is larger than the Na/Si value at a depth of 30 nm. 3 . The method for producing a zeolite according to claim 1 , wherein the crystallization is performed by hydrothermal synthesis. 4 . The method for producing a zeolite according to claim 2 , wherein the crystallization is performed by hydrothermal synthesis.
